How to Install Brand new Rolls of Laminating Movie on Your Roll Laminator

Move laminators are helpful machines making it possible for you to shield and preserve posters, maps, retail exhibits, and more. However, a number of people are intimidated by the appliance and find them tough to use. Perhaps the most difficult part of using a move laminator is loading fresh film on to that. This article will walk you through the task so you can do it with a minimal amount of trouble:
First, you will need to make certain you have the right video for your machine. Be sure to look in the guide to find out what video you need. You will need to look closely at core size and also film thickness.

Change your laminator on try not to let it get as well hot. (You might burn up yourself otherwise.) Eliminate the machine’s feed tray. You will be replacing both rolls of movie – the one in the top and the one on the bottom.
Grab a GBC Zippy Knife and carefully cut the actual film that’s among the heated paint rollers and the film comes. When you do this you’ll want to make sure that you don’t accidentally cut the heated up rollers. Doing so can easily render your laminator pretty much useless.

Raise your laminator’s security shield and remove your rolls of movie that are already set up. Removing them may be tricky, especially if the wheels are hot. You have to remove the rolls cautiously so that the adhesive does not come into contact with the rollers. If this happens, you will end up using a mess. If you’re experiencing difficulty removing the bottom spin, make sure that the securing screw is loosened. It will make all the difference.

Now you have to install the new bottom roll of movie. Slide a key adapter into among the new rolls as well as them insert a movie shaft into the central adapter. Then, position the core adapter on the shaft and go back the retaining collar to its original situation. Make sure the screw can be tightened and then decrease the bottom idle club. The film can unroll from the bottom, much like a roll involving paper towels on a tray. Unroll a couple of feet associated with film and put the actual idle bar rear where it connected. The roll needs to be in the hex-shaped brake link on the left and the round hole on the right side.
Do it again the above steps for your top roll. Yet again, make sure the film can unroll from the bottom if not the machine won’t work appropriately.
Replace the nourish tray to its unique position under the bottom part roll of film. Take your threading card and slip it between the give food to tray and the video. Make sure you feed the cardboard through the rollers in order that the film will be properly wrapped around all of them.
Put the safety protect back into place along with press the laminator’s “run” option. The threading credit card should come out of the back of the machine. When it can, remove it and then proceed laminating like you normally would.
